Manager, Recruitment and Retention
Hope Services is Silicon Valley’s leading provider of services to people with developmental disabilities and mental health needs. The Manager, Recruitment and Retention is responsible for developing and managing recruitment and staff retention strategies, ensuring a diverse and talented workforce, and leading the talent acquisition team to meet hiring goals.

Responsibilities
Lead strategic talent acquisition initiatives that align with the organization’s long-term goals and growth plans
Collaborate with department heads and HR team to forecast staffing needs and develop proactive sourcing plans
Build and maintain the organization’s employer brand through external partnerships, events, and marketing initiatives
Partner with HR leadership to drive diversity, equity, and inclusion initiatives in talent acquisition
Manage the end-to-end recruitment process, ensuring efficient, equitable, and high-quality hiring experience and monitor hiring process effectiveness
Identify and leverage various recruitment channels (job boards, social media, networking events, employee referrals) to build strong candidate pipelines
Consistently communicate with Hope’s hiring partners (JobTarget, Job Elephant etc) to evaluate hiring trends
Oversee proactive sourcing of qualified candidates for all open positions with emphasis on the quality and diversity of applicant pools and make recommendations and identify strategies to increase both, as needed
Assist in the interviewing process for senior or key roles and provide guidance to hiring managers on selection decisions
Ensure compliance with employment laws and company policies throughout the hiring process
Utilize ATS system efficiently to manage workflows, candidate data, and analytics
Align recruitment strategies with long-term retention goals by hiring for cultural fit, role alignment, and career path potential
Partner with HR to analyze turnover trends and integrate insights into talent acquisition strategies
Build a positive rapport with newly hired employees by employing strategies like periodic check-ins (90-day, probationary, yearly and so on)
Gather feedback on the hiring/onboarding/orientation and new hire training process and suggest process changes as needed
Lead the exit interview/survey process and report on employee turnover trends
Lead and manage the talent acquisition team to deliver on hiring goals and KPIs
Provide coaching, development, and performance feedback to the talent acquisition team to build capability and engagement
Maintain and report recruitment and retention dashboard with trends and metrics such as time-to-fill, vacancy rate, hire success rate, reasons for termination etc
Analyze data to drive continuous improvement in recruitment practices and outcomes

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field or an approved combination of education and experience
Proven experience (7+ years) in talent acquisition, with at least 2 years in a managerial or team lead role
Strong knowledge of sourcing techniques, interviewing methods, and employment legislation
Excellent interpersonal, communication, and stakeholder management skills
Ability to prioritize and manage multiple requisitions and projects simultaneously
Experience working with Applicant Tracking Systems (Lever is a plus)
Strong analytical skills to interpret data and drive continuous improvement in recruitment practices
Ability to think strategically and adapt plans to a fast-changing environment
Proficient in utilization of MS Office Suite and other tools for effective reporting
